G&R/EN/Advice relating to Electricity Levy Exemptions - SOFT MARKET TESTING
Descriptions
Bristol City Council (BCC) owns and operates two large onshore wind turbines and a solar farm. The power output from these is sleeved to nominated BCC buildings under a Power Purchase Agreement (PPA), creating a virtual self-supply. As the power output from these systems falls below the thresholds set out in the Electricity (Class Exemptions from the Requirement for a Licence) Order 2001, BCC should qualify for the appropriate licence exemptions. As such, BCC should not be liable to pay levies obligated on licenced suppliers. However, these exemptions need to be registered with the appropriate authorities before our sleeving supplier is able to apply the appropriate discount. It is the registration of these exemptions under the Regulations that we are seeking support for.
